heres my engine half built up, port polished 1800 mk2 head (carb not gti) big valves GTi camshaft, 2litre bottom end running the mk2 gti flywheel and a mk1 gti gear box :D (thanks to all the people on her who have pointed me in the right direction!  :y: ) the manifold is painted red with vht paint untill i get her on the road and take her down to a local exhaust engineering firm for some discounted 4-2-1 manifold and straight through stainless system.

Just wondering… I was thinking of buying a lower front strut brace and wanted to know why yours was difficult to fit? The front of my car is a bit bent thanks to the previous owner :x and so its gonna be even worse for me.

Keep up the good work.

Will

Post

Back to the top
where it bolts to the chassis leg at the bottom, with the wishbone bolt.

over time as its like a 20 odd year old car the chassis legs have moved even ferther apart due to the metal sagging and bending if you know what i mean??

but its nothing serious its only like 2 or 3 mm but this is enough to put one bolt hole out of alignment and you have to pull the leg back in to get the bolt, ive fittd one on my mates cabbi, it went straight on, mine was a bit harder, just cross your fingers and hope yours wont have saggd that much lol
